What Is Decorative Ink Stroke and Calligraphic Brush?

Decorative ink stroke refers to stylized lines created using a calligraphic brush, often with a natural, hand-drawn feel. These strokes can vary in thickness, texture, and flow, depending on the brush type and technique used. A calligraphic brush is designed to mimic traditional writing instruments, allowing for expressive and dynamic line work. When isolated on a white background, as in EPS or JPG formats, these elements become highly adaptable for use in digital and print media.

The combination of decorative ink stroke and calligraphic brush creates a visually appealing aesthetic that adds depth and personality to designs. This style is particularly popular in branding, typography, and artistic illustrations where a sense of craftsmanship and authenticity is desired.

How to Choose and Use Decorative Ink Stroke Elements

When selecting decorative ink stroke and calligraphic brush elements, consider the intended use and the overall design aesthetic. If you're aiming for a modern, clean look, opt for subtle strokes with minimal texture. For a more traditional or artistic feel, choose elements with bolder lines and more intricate details.

It's also important to evaluate the resolution and format of the files. High-resolution EPS or JPG files ensure that the elements remain crisp and clear, even when scaled up. Always check the licensing terms to make sure the elements can be used for your specific purpose, whether it's personal, commercial, or educational.

Once selected, experiment with placement and styling. Try layering the elements over different backgrounds, adjusting opacity, or combining them with other design elements to achieve the desired effect. Don't be afraid to test different combinations to find what works best for your project.
